Using Google Gemini App

1. Text Prompts

This will be your primary and most powerful tool for posing highly specific, conceptually challenging questions across all your B.E. subjects. You can seek detailed explanations of engineering principles, request step-by-step derivations of formulas, and even ask for different perspectives on design challenges.

use text prompts on google gemini

2. Voice Input

For quick conceptual clarifications during intensive study sessions, brainstorming solutions to design problems, or even rapidly reviewing key formulas, definitions, and theorems on the go, utilize voice commands to interact with Gemini. This offers an incredibly convenient avenue for instant academic assistance, ensuring no crucial detail or challenging concept remains unresolved during your B.E. journey.

how to use voice to ask google gemini questions

3. Image Input

When faced with a complex circuit diagram, a confusing flowchart, a structural engineering blueprint, a thermodynamic cycle diagram, or a graph illustrating experimental data from your B.E. material, simply capture a clear image and upload it to Gemini. You can then ask targeted questions about the components of a system, the logic flow of a process, the forces acting on a structure, the stages of a cycle, or request explanations of data trends.
